AERODYNAMICS ENGINEER, TURBO MACHINERY (STARSHIP)

An engineer in this role will lead the design, development, and qualification of rotating and stationary flow path components for turbo machinery applications at Space

X, taking designs from concept to flight or other operations. Success requires strong technical knowledge of turbo machinery, coupled aero/hydro and mechanical design, and broad turbo machinery system understanding, with the ability to collaborate with a wider team of specialists. The role emphasizes aggressive manufacturing goals, minimum cost/weight, and tight schedules.

Responsibilities
  • Design, build, and test turbopump pumps and/or turbines for Starship propulsion systems
  • Own critical turbo machinery components and hardware
  • Perform aero/hydro sizing and flow path design/analysis for turbopumps and other turbo machinery in spacecraft systems
  • Ensure detailed mechanical analysis of turbopump components/systems, reviewed and meeting life and reliability targets
  • Collaborate with designers to prepare accurate models and drawings for turbopump assemblies and components; ensure manufacturability with available processes (or develop a process to enable them)
  • Interface with production teams to translate designs into flight hardware
  • Collaborate with teams developing other systems (e.g., combustion devices, valves) to ensure integrated and balanced turbo machinery design
  • Support component and assembly testing, define test configurations/processes, review results
  • Lead the resolution of turbopump issues during development/qualification testing
  • Support ongoing design improvements and manufacturing improvements to reduce cost and lead time
